It is with profound sadness that we announce the passing of our mother, Doris E. Parks. Mom left us for her eternal home on April 2, 2015 at The Dr. George Dumont Hospital. Born in Fredericton, NB in June 1928, she was the daughter of the late Garnet and Elsie ( Morehouse) McCoombs. Mom was predeceased by her husband and our father, Gerald B. (Gerry)Parks in 1983.
Doris was a loving and devoted mother to her three children, daughter Beverly Dixon (Bill) of Moncton, her sons, Richard Parks (Shelley) of Fredericton and Robin Parks (Cheryl) of Calgary. A cherished grandmother to Krista and Kami Dixon of Moncton, Kaitlyn Parks of Calgary, great granddaughter, Bryanna Dixon, Moncton and one step-grandson, Matthew McElman and family of Fredericton. She is also survived by a sister in law Edith Parks and numerous nieces and nephews and cousins. Raised by her foster parents, mom’s cousins were like her sisters. Isabelle Hamill, Ruby Clanfield and Martha Sparkes predeceased her.
Doris was a homemaker and devout member of St. Andrews Anglican Church, Newcastle. She loved to travel, watch curling both live and on TV and cheered the Blue Jays on. She was a member of the St. Andrews Ladies Church Guild and Altar Guild, Miramichi Rebekkah Lodge, The Order of the Eastern Star and had volunteered with Meals on Wheels. More than anything, mom loved a good laugh! She had a quick wit and thoroughly enjoyed her Monday afternoon Rummoli group and Friday night suppers with friends. She was known to sing a good version of Take Me Home To Bartibogue which family enjoyed as recently as late fall when she visited Calgary. Mom was a strong lady. She handled her cancer diagnosis in the same fashion that she lived her life, with courage, strength and determination. She was blessed with many, many good friends.
